Etymology[edit]

From Hokkien 瀉衰泻衰 (sià-soe).

Adjective[edit]

sia suay (comparative more sia suay, superlative most sia suay)

  1. (Singapore, colloquial) Causing embarrassment or disgrace to others.
    • 1989 November 2, “From love songs to 'pai kia' tune. Karaoke is BIG business.”, in The Straits Times, Singapore:
      Most of those who sing these songs are too drunk to be stopped. Sia suay (Hokkien for bringing shame to the entire clan) only.

Verb[edit]

sia suay (invariable)

  1. (Singapore, colloquial) To disgrace; to cause embarrassment for others.
